Study of the Temperature Distribution in the Bituminous Concrete Facing Used in Fill Dams in the Semi Arid Region of West Algeria

Authors : Lakhdar Djemili and Mohamed Mansour Chiblak

Abstract: The main objective of this research was first of all to establish a mathematical relationship for the maximum temperature on the surface of the bituminous concrete facing used in existing and future earth dam`s construction in the semi arid region of west Algeria without taking any in-situ experimental measurements. Secondly it was to study the influence of some factors on this temperature. The results which have been obtained showed that the maximum temperature on the surface of the bituminous concrete facing was proportional to the air temperature of the site and also depend on the climatic, geographical and geometric factors.
